About KCNK6

Summary

Enables Potassium Channel activity. Predicted to be involved in potassium ion transmembrane transport and stabilization of membrane potential. Predicted to act upstream of or within negative regulation of systemic arterial blood pressure and regulation of resting membrane potential. Predicted to be integral component of plasma membrane. Orthologous to human KCNK6 (potassium two pore domain channel subfamily K member 6). [provided by Alliance of Genome Resources, Apr 2022]
